San Bernardino Daily Sun (San Bernardino, California)
October 21, 1899 (Saturday)

"IN MEMORIAM.

The death yesterday afternoon of Mrs. Adeline West, takes from San Bernardino another of the early pioneers, and one who has not only lived here until she has endeared herself to a very large circle of intimate friends, but has raised and seen grow up around her, a family of sons and daughters that any mother might be proud of. She has indeed, been a "Mother in Israel," and whether in the home circle or among friends and acquaintances, she has drawn to her the love and affection of all who knew her.

She leaves to mourn their loss, a fond husband, who for over half a century has trod the path of life with her, and eight children, all of whom are living in this city, and two sisters, who survive her. She herself was one of ten sisters and four brothers, and their mother lived to witness the marriage of her fourteen children.

The deceased was born in 1824, in Marion county, Alabama, the daughter of Jeptha Weeks, a farmer and mechanic, and was married in Mississippi, December 30, 1847, to James Monroe West, who survives her after 52 years of married life.

They left their home in Mississippi on February 21, 1856, to try their fortunes in the west, and reached San Bernardino on November 8, 1856. On arrival here, Mr. West bought the land where they have lived since their arrival, 43 years ago, and here they raised their family of nine children, all but one of whom are residing here at the present time.

Their names Samuel M. West, Simon Jeptha West, Sarah Jane West, now Mrs. W. H. Mee, James Monroe West [Jr.], Nancy Abigail West, now Mrs. Charles A. More, Mary Elizabeth West, now Mrs. Frank Yager, Thomas Jefferson West, and George Washington West. She leaves two sisters here, Mrs. Roberts and Mrs. Ridley, and a number of grandchildren.

The funeral will take place on Sunday afternoon at 2 o'clock from the family homestead on East Third street."
